Intel Core i5-4210M has a maximum frequency of 2.60 GHz. 2 Cores. Power consumption of 37 W. Released in Q2/2014.

Intel Core i5-2520M has a maximum frequency of 2.50 GHz. 2 Cores. Power consumption of 35 W. Released in Q1/2011.
